[Pro.50] Kazimierz Jedrzejewski Ph.D. – Head of the<br />
project coordinated by the Center for Technology<br />
Transfer Warsaw University of Technology; July<br />
2004 – June 2007; Technology and realization of<br />
fibre Bragg gratings, (in Polish – Opracowanie<br />
technologii i konstrukcji oraz wykonanie<br />
swiatlowodowych siatek Bragga). Two<br />
technologies: phase mask and interferometric<br />
will be applied for Bragg grating inscription on<br />
fiber core in spectral range 1000-1600nm.<br />
Double clad fibres will be also used. Participants:<br />
Lech Lewandowski Ph.D., Professor Jerzy<br />
Helsztynski, Wieslaw Jasiewicz M.Sc.<br />
[Pro.51] Ryszard Romaniuk Professor – Head of the<br />
project coordinated by the Center for Technology<br />
Transfer Warsaw University of Technology; July<br />
2004 – June 2007; Technology of Capillary<br />
Optical Fibers, (in Polish – Opracowanie<br />
technologii i konstrukcji oraz wykonanie<br />
swiatlowodów kapilarnych), participant:<br />
Krzysztof Pozniak Ph.D. Capillary optical fibers<br />
are experimentally manufactured for research<br />
purposes. The fibres are considered for design of<br />
photonic sensors and optoelectronic functional<br />
components.<br />

[Pro.53] Project coordinated by the Center for<br />
Technology Transfer Warsaw University of<br />
Technology; July 2004 – June 2007, Head of the<br />
project - Artur Dybko D.Sc. Optical Fibre<br />
Chemical Sensor, (in Polish - Swiatlowodowe<br />
czujniki chemiczne). Technology of so called<br />
chemical optrodes is researched. The optrodes<br />
will serve for integrated multiparameter<br />
measurements in aqueous environment. The<br />
chemical microsensors are researched to part of<br />
photonic microsystems. Partic ipants: Professor<br />
Ryszard Romaniuk, Krzysztof Pozniak Ph.D.<br />
[Pro.54] Project coordinated by the Center for<br />
Technology Transfer Warsaw University of<br />
Technology; July 2004 – June 2007, Head of the<br />
project - Professor Krzysztof Holejko;<br />
Optoelectronic Sensor of Air Opacity, (in Polish -<br />
Czujnik przejrzystosci powietrza). Optoelectronic<br />
sensor for detection of precipitation is designing<br />
for airborne industry and meteorological<br />
services. Participants: Professor Ryszard<br />
Romaniuk, Krzysztof Pozniak Ph.D.<br />
